Assembly member had no hand in Mahama killing - Lawyer

Mr George Bernard Shaw said Baah did not take part in the alleged lynching of the military officer.

“The assembly member did not conspire with the other accused persons to cause Major Mahama’s death. The facts of the case, as presented by the prosecution, do not reflect what exactly happened,’’ he said.

He made the claim during the hearing of the case at the Accra Central District court on Monday.

He subsequently rejected the charge of conspiracy to commit murder levelled against the accused, describing it as “improper charge’’.

The presiding magistrate, Mr Joshua Caleb Abaidoo however, stopped the lawyer from advancing his line of argument, saying that the court was still awaiting the the Attorney-General’s (A-G’s) advice on the case.

The judge told counsel that the accused had not been officially charged, adding: “I don’t really see where this is coming from.’’

The prosecutor, Deputy Superintendent of Police (DSP) Mr George Amegah, had earlier pleaded with the court to stop counsel from going into the merits of the case.

“We have come before this court for committal and, therefore, counsel should not go into the merits until the trial because if we allege, we must prove,’’ he said.

Meanwhile, at the hearing, the prosecution, with the permission of the court, amended the charge sheet to accommodate the two new accused persons, Bismarck Abanga and Emmanuel Baidoo, who were arrested recently.

All the accused persons have been provisionally charged with murder and conspiracy to commit murder.

The case was adjourned to October 10, 2017.
